Company Overview:

MACOM designs and manufactures semiconductor products for Data Center, Telecommunication, and Industrial and Defense applications. Headquartered in Lowell, Massachusetts, MACOM has design centers and sales offices throughout North America, Europe, and Asia. MACOM is certified to the ISO9001 international quality standard and ISO14001 environmental management standard.

With over 65 years of application expertise, MACOM operates multiple design centers and fabrication facilities for Si, GaAs, and InP, along with manufacturing, assembly, and testing facilities worldwide. We also offer foundry services as a core competency.

MACOM sells and distributes products globally through a combination of direct sales, authorized representatives, and industry distributors, with a trained sales team knowledgeable about our entire portfolio.
